TEST III ENUMERATION: Read the following statements carefully enumerate what is being
asked.

a. Ten Types of Robots


31. Industrial Robotics
32. Service Robotics
33. Medical Robotics
34. Autonomous Mobile Robots (AMRs)
35. Humanoid Robots
36. Exploration Robots
37. Agricultural Robotics
38. Military and Defense Robotics
39. Educational Robotics
40. Swarm Robotics

b. Five Applications of Virtual Reality


41. Gaming
42. Healthcare
43. Education
44. Retail
45. Military

c. Five Applications of Augmented Reality


46. Healthcare
47. Education
48. Marketing
49. Architecture
50. Retail
